首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Yii2,用于卡地克导出的自定义css样式

Yii2是一个基于PHP的高性能Web应用框架,它提供了丰富的功能和组件,使开发人员能够快速构建可扩展和可靠的Web应用程序。以下是关于Yii2的完善且全面的答案:

概念:

Yii2是一个开源的PHP框架,它采用了MVC(Model-View-Controller)设计模式,旨在提高开发效率和性能。它具有灵活的架构,允许开发人员根据项目需求进行定制和扩展。

分类:

Yii2属于后端开发框架,主要用于构建Web应用程序。它提供了丰富的功能和组件,包括数据库访问、缓存、表单验证、身份验证、RBAC(基于角色的访问控制)等。

优势:

  1. 高性能:Yii2采用了一些优化策略和缓存机制,使得应用程序具有出色的性能表现。
  2. 易于学习和使用:Yii2具有清晰的文档和简洁的代码结构,使得开发人员能够快速上手并提高开发效率。
  3. 安全性:Yii2提供了强大的安全功能,包括输入验证、输出过滤、CSRF(跨站请求伪造)防护等,帮助开发人员构建安全可靠的应用程序。
  4. 扩展性:Yii2支持模块化开发和插件机制,使得开发人员能够轻松地扩展和定制应用程序。
  5. 社区支持:Yii2拥有庞大的开发者社区,提供了丰富的资源和解决方案,开发人员可以从中获取帮助和支持。

应用场景:

Yii2适用于各种规模的Web应用程序开发,包括企业级应用、电子商务平台、社交网络、内容管理系统等。它可以满足不同项目的需求,并提供高效的开发和维护。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(CVM):腾讯云提供的弹性计算服务,可用于部署和运行Yii2应用程序。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):腾讯云提供的高可用、可扩展的关系型数据库服务,适用于存储Yii2应用程序的数据。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(COS):腾讯云提供的安全可靠的对象存储服务,可用于存储Yii2应用程序的静态资源和文件。详情请参考:https://cloud.tencent.com/product/cos

以上是关于Yii2的完善且全面的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

群分享:Markdown + CSS 实现微信公众号排版

CSS 指层叠样式表 (Cascading Style Sheets),样式定义如何显示 HTML 元素,样式通常存储在样式表中,外部样式表可以极大提高工作效率,外部样式表通常存储在 CSS 文件中。...目前并可能未来长期是本星球上最流行开源托管服务提供商,程序员们不具名简历集散(通过询问一只程序猿在 Github 上代码贡献量来评价ta是一个什么样程序猿)。...解决方案 Markdown Here + 自定义 CSS 支持自定义 CSS Markdown 编辑器(以下简称 Editor S) + 自定义 CSS 不支持自定义 CSS Markdown...CSS 自定义一些 CSS 并保存为文件 在 Editor S 中导入自定义 CSS 文件 在 Editor S 中书写 导出渲染后 HTML ,复制粘帖到微信公众号编辑器中 插图,修订 发布...4月15日我也许会重开一次关于 Markdown 写作微课,平台暂定千聊,课程免费,欢迎带着问题来提问。(附上课程邀请) 关于 Markdown 你可能想知道 邀请 3.

5.3K60
  • 让 JavaScript 与 CSS 和 Sass 对话

    当然也有大量尝试。但是我所想到是一些简单而直观内容——不涉及结构更改,而是使用 CSS 自定义属性甚至 Sass 变量。...CSS 自定义属性和 JavaScript 自定义属性在这里应该不会令人感到惊讶。自浏览器提供支持以来,他们一直在做一件事就是与 JavaScript 协同工作以设置和操作值。...其背后逻辑非常简单:自定义属性是样式一部分,因此它们是计算样式一部分。...这样我们就可以从 HTML 标记内联样式中获得自定义属性值。...所以无法用与 CSS 自定义属性相同方式从 JavaScript 访问它们(可以在 DOM 中以计算样式访问它们)。 我们需要通过修改自己构建过程来改变这一点。

    93610

    京东快递H5项目接入vite实战

    Tech 导读 本文介绍了如何在开发阶段将vite应用于vue 2.x 工程,从而提高研发开发体验与效率。...运行时提示 process 不存在,vite 中已经不通过 process 获取自定义变量,需要使用 import.meta,但是考虑到 vite 仅用于开发阶段,不应对项目进行破坏性兼容,因此考虑在全局自定义...@jd/pandora-mobile 组件库样式文件导入不生效,解决方案有两种,一种是通过配置 css 预处理插件配置(preprocessorOptions)将组件库样式添加为额外全局样式,但是这种方案可能存在样式优先级问题...常量导入导出在文件之间存在循环依赖报错,需将常量统一导出处理。...就结果来说 vite 在项目启动上确实速度很快,但是由于运行时打包方式,首次页面交互体验顿明显; 2. sdk 兼容仍有待优化。

    42010

    Giselle 主题帮助文档 & FAQ

    社交 基础资料:自定义侧边栏与网站常规社交信息,如:微博、QQ 其他资料::github地址(可选)、个人资料阅读更多链接地址(可链接到关于页面)。 风格 颜色:网站字体、按钮等颜色设置。...网页::按钮样式、字体样式。 皮肤设置::提供五种网页皮肤设置。 ? 文章 文章列表:自定义文章摘录与文章摘录文字长度设置 文章内容页::面包屑导航、分享按钮、转载声明。...文章管理::禁止文章自动保存与删除文章修订版本,用于编辑文章时。 ? 评论 评论再编辑:访客提交评论之后会出现重新编辑选项,但这必须在刷新网页之前。...代码 自定义CSS:填写CSS代码,一般用于临时修改网页样式使用 自定义javascript:填写JS代码 统计代码:填写JS统计代码,路易用是CNZZ统计 统计报表查看链接:统计链接图标或者文字会被隐藏...备份 保存现在设置,你也可以将数据导出到本地保存,有必要时恢复这些设置。 ?

    1.6K20

    两种最简单方式教会你如何实现前端一键换肤!( ̄_, ̄ )

    style.setProperty()是用于在JavaScript中设置元素样式方法。...具体来说,document.documentElement.style.setProperty() 方法可以用于动态设置根元素 CSS 样式属性。...别慌下面还有更加简单。 第二种方法:html 自定义属性配合 css 属性选择器 当谈到HTML自定义属性和CSS属性选择器时,它们分别是HTML和CSS中非常有用功能。...让我详细介绍一下它们: HTML自定义属性: 在HTML中,可以使用自定义属性来存储额外信息或数据,这些属性并不会影响文档结构或样式,但可以通过JavaScript或CSS来访问和操作。...*/ [data-color="red"] { color: red; } 使用CSS属性选择器可以根据元素自定义属性值来样式化元素,为页面的样式定制提供了更多灵活性和控制力。

    50310

    那些优秀网络爬虫工具介绍,最后亮了!| 码云周刊第 16 期

    2、使用 Vue2 和 Yii2 进行前后端分离开发 本文介绍使用Vue2单页面程序作为前台,以Yii2搭建后台提供API,进行前后端分离开发入门知识。本文适合Vue2,Yii2爱好者观看。...- 用于HTML提取简单API。 - 使用POJO进行注释来自定义抓取工具,无需配置。 - 多线程和分发支持。 - 易于集成 3、分布式爬虫系统 YayCrawler ?...- 页面下载、分析、持久化模块化,可自定义扩展 - 采集日志记录(Mongodb支持) - 页面数据自定义存储(Mysql、Mongodb) - 深度遍历,同时可自定义深度层次...代码完全开源,适合用于垂直领域数据采集和爬虫二次开发。...特点: - 支持web界面方式摘取规则配置(css selector & regex); - 包含无界面的浏览器引擎(phantomjs),支持js产生内容抓取; - 用http

    2.3K100

    盘点7个开源WPF控件

    4、可托拉拽WPF选项控件,强大好用! 项目简介 这是一个基于WPF开发,可扩展、高度可定制、轻量级UI组件,支持拖拉拽功能,可以让开发人员快速实现需要选项窗口系统。...特色功能 1、拖拉拽标签; 2、浮动窗口、多文档界面; 3、支持MVVM; 4、支持Chrome风格标签、支持IE风格透明风格; 5、可自定义样式; 6、支持调整窗口透明度、窗口大小、最大化等样式...6、一个强大Excel控件,支持WinForm、WPF、Android 项目简介 这是一个开源表格控制组件,支持Winform、WPF和Android平台,可以方便加载、修改和导出Excel文件,...支持数据格式、大纲、公式计算、图表、脚本执行等、还支持触摸滑动,可以方便操作表格。...控件核心功能 1、工作簿:支持多工作表、工作表选项控件; 2、工作表:支持合并、取消合并、单元格编辑、数据格式、自定义单元格、填充数据序列、单元格文本旋转、富文本、剪贴板、下拉列表单元格、边框、样式

    1.9K20

    SAP 2023分析云 新功能所有细节介绍

    这使得用户可以使用不同颜色或者符合自身品牌调性颜色来呈现差异: 可以为正值、负值和空置配置差异颜色 有三种方式可以自定义差异颜色:主题首选项、自定义CSS或者通过差异面板为每个视觉对象配置差异颜色...以下是目前已经适用于优化故事体验功能: 导出为PDF格式(改进对话框) 在“全部导出为CSV”中包含重命名后度量和维 SAP通用数据模型 复制与粘贴——跨页(优化设计体验) 数据发掘 – 数据分析器...这一功能不支持表格样式设置以及UI元素通用外观设置。...数据集成 启用传统导出选项 目前您可以在模型首选项中数据和性能选项下找到“启用传统导出”选项,该一选项可以让您使用OData服务将数据导出至其应用程序,如SAP S4/HANA、SAP Business...查看所有“API订阅” 我们目前已经在连接工具中增加了一个新订阅概览选项用于管理SAP分析云租户中所有增量订阅。

    31230

    YII2框架中日志配置与使用方法实例分析

    本文实例讲述了YII2框架中日志配置与使用方法。分享给大家供大家参考,具体如下: YII2中给我们提供了非常方便日志组件,只需要简单配置一下就可以使用。...::warning('我是一条支付警告', 'pay'); //错误 YII::error('我是一条支付错误', 'pay'); 由于上面的配置我们使用了DbTarget,我们还需要添加一张日志表,用于记录我们日志...日志消息格式化,我们可以自定义日志前缀。 'log' = [ 'traceLevel' = YII_DEBUG ?...消息刷新和导出 'log' = [ 'traceLevel' = YII_DEBUG ?...,如果频繁读取文件或数据库来写日志,会造成严重IO消耗,降低系统性能,这也是YII2一个优化吧。

    1.6K10

    Premiere Pro 2022 for Mac(pr 2022)v22.6.2最新中文激活版

    Premiere Pro 2022 for Mac最新中文激活版一款适用于电影、电视和 Web 业界领先视频编辑软件。...Premiere Pro 2022 for Mac图片Pr2022新增功能2022 年 8 月版(22.6 版) Premiere Pro 中设计工具(结合“文本”面板搜索和编辑功能)可帮助您为任何视频项目制作出效果出众自定义字幕和图形...得益于新上下文菜单,可以更快速、更轻松在设计中编辑任何图层。适用于文本和形状图层仅蒙版填充您现在可以仅将蒙版应用于图层填充,从而允许在不包含于蒙版情况下对描边和阴影进行渲染。...文本和形状图层上下文菜单现在,您可以右键单击“节目监视器”中字幕,然后从上下文菜单中选择编辑属性,以打开“基本图形”面板。在此面板中,您可以使用字体、颜色和样式选项自定义字幕。...从“图形”选项中将字幕导出为文本文件您现在可以使用“图形”选项导出选项导出字幕和 Premiere Pro 或 After Effects 动态图形模板中文本。

    1.4K60

    面向前端开发人员VSCode自动化插件

    Live SASS编译器 可以通过Live SASS编译器将你SASS或SCSS文件轻松自动编译成CSS,并在代码编辑器本身内部实时编译,并自动在浏览器中为你提供应用程序或编译后样式实时预览,...快速状态栏控制 可自定义扩展名(.css或.min.css) 可自定义导出CSS样式(扩展、压缩、压缩、嵌套) 可自定义导出CSS文件位置 自动重命名标签 在一个包含成百上千行代码应用程序中,你是否有因为要更改一个...HTML标签而忘记或错误更改了成对另一个标签?...ESLint 代码检测是用于检查程序中语法错误或不按特定风格准则代码, 而ESLint这样代码检测工具允许开发人员在不执行JavaScript代码情况下发现其代码问题。...pre-commit hook用于检查即将提交快照。 通过使用pre-commit hook,您可以检查代码样式、尾部多余空格、不需要导入,或者检查有关新方法适当文档。

    1K20

    使用chrome调试CSS

    ####查看外部样式表 1、在 styles 选项中,单击CSS规则旁边链接以打开定义规则外部样式表。可以查看样式源文件。...####仅查看实际应用于元素CSS 1、styles 选项中会显示适用于元素所有规则,包括已被覆盖声明,如果对覆盖声明不感兴趣,可以点击与 styles 相邻 computed 选项,仅查看实际应用于元素...####修改已有样式规则声明 1、在需要更改原有样式上双击,修改样式规则,并按 Enter 键。 给元素添加CSS类 1、在 styles 选项中点击 .cls 。...页面重新加载,Coverage选项提供浏览器加载每个文件使用多少CSS(和JavaScript)概述。绿色代表使用CSS。红色表示未使用CSS。...在“ 材质设计”调板,自定义调色板或页面调色板之间切换。DevTools根据它在样式表中找到颜色生成页面调色板。 使用吸管从页面上取样 打开拾色器时,默认情况下吸管 滴管处于打开状态。

    5.5K20

    巧用滑动选项,提升用户体验

    开始吧 首先,我们需要一个真正滑动选项组件。有很多可供选择提供了不同特性这样组件,这里我们将会使用Onsen UI提供选项,它允许在滑动时候执行自定义操作。...在顶部,可以使用更多设置来修改默认表现形式,添加一些额外自定义属性设置,可以获得独一无二应用程序样式。...tabs属性包括了一个选项数组。 page和 label这两个属性都可以被选项组件自己使用来描述这个选项内容和外观,但是这并不能阻止我们用自定义属性如 theme或者其它属性。...注意, swipeTheme计算属性是怎么传递给工具栏(通过 style属性)和选项(通过 tabbar-style属性)。无论什么时候改变这个属性,这两个组件样式都会更新。...当然,通过提供不同比率我们可以想生成多少就生成多少中间点。 这不仅仅适用于物理距离,在之前代码里,我们想根据滑动位置逐渐把一个颜色变换成另一个颜色。

    1.4K20

    CSS 20大酷刑

    这是一段使用自定义字体文本。...如果想了解更多关于网络选项使用和介绍,可以查看Chrome Developer关于Performance介绍 Lighthouse选项 Lighthouse是一个开源自动化工具,用于提高网页质量...避免使用 @import @import 是一种CSS规则,用于在一个CSS文件中引入另一个CSS文件。通过使用@import,我们可以将多个CSS文件合并成一个文件,以便更好组织和管理样式。。...因此,尽管 will-change 可以用于性能优化,但在使用时需要谨慎考虑上述因素,确保它被正确应用在需要进行复杂变换或动画元素上。...考虑关键 CSS 那些使用谷歌页面分析工具的人通常会看到建议“内联关键CSS”或“减少渲染阻塞样式表”。加载CSS文件会阻塞渲染,因此可以通过以下步骤来提高性能: 提取用于渲染视窗上方元素样式

    22230

    推荐 5 款可以提升工具效率 Chrome 插件

    Peeper CSS Peeper,是一款提取网页样式插件 作为一款 CSS 查看器,它可以直观高效获取网页元素属性、宽高,字体样式 使用方法很简单,只需要点击插件,鼠标点击网页上某一个控件...,右上角会展示目标元素 CSS 样式属性 插件地址: https://chrome.google.com/webstore/detail/css-peeper/mbnbehikldjhnfehhnaidhjhoofhpehk.../related JSON 查看器专业版 在 Chrome 应用市场,有很多 JSON 格式化插件,但是这款插件除了常规功能,还包含样式自定义、「 图表视图 」展示等功能,用户体验做更好 另外,这款插件可以随意选择一个节点...另外,还可以通过关键字查询历史浏览记录 在设置中,可以导入、导出历史记录,还能配置自动备份周期 插件地址: https://chrome.google.com/webstore/detail/history-trends-unlimited.../pnmchffiealhkdloeffcdnbgdnedheme/related Ajax Interceptor 这款插件可以修改 Ajax 请求返回结果,一般用于 Mock 数据、接口联调测试

    1.3K20

    生产力 | Markdown 为何物

    都是通过 CSS 实现(严谨说是都可以通过 CSS 实现)。...,大多数 Markdown 编辑器支持自定义样式,你可以粘贴自己样式代码片段以覆盖编辑器默认样式表,或者上传一份你自己完整样式文件,编辑器会完全按照你样式进行呈现。...如果你想带着样式将内容发给别人,你可以试一下编辑器导出选项,大多数编辑器都支持将 Markdown 导出为带样式 Html 和不带样式 Html、PDF、图片等……如果你有更多导出需求,你可以通过一些简单技术手段...内容与样式分离与导出为 Html 并不冲突,导出为 Html 导出仍然是单独一份文件,编辑器自动将外部样式表中相关样式转换为内部样式表写入到 Html 中。...并且完美适配平台样式;对于尚未支持 Markdown 主流发布平台,Markdown 生态中也有相应转换工具可以方便将 Markdown 转换为目标格式内容。

    88620

    构建一套最佳React 组件文件结构

    但是,同样重要(也是经常被忽视)是如何最好构造组件问题。 包含在组件目录中内容 组件是每个React应用程序构建块。因此,它们本身可以被视为小型项目。组件应尽可能独立(但不能更多)。...因此,将它们放在我们组件旁边非常有意义。 Story Storybook(storybook.js.org)是一款出色工具,可用于独立开发组件。...Styles 样式文件 使用CSS-in-JS时,可以直接在组件文件中创建样式组件。如果我们选择了CSS模块,则样式文件应与组件位于其目录中。...Assets 资源文件 图像,图标或其他特定于组件资源文件应直接放置在组件目录中。再次托管! Utils 工具类 工具类程序可以包括从辅助函数到自定义钩子所有内容。...这就是为什么重要是要指出我上面提出只是一个模板。 尽管我发现这种结构适用于各种场景,但是每个React应用程序都是唯一,或者至少具有其特质。

    1.1K10
    领券